249 cm3 liquid-cooled, 4-stroke Single with DOHC 4-valve head pumps out a wide spread of power.
-
Claimed
power - 43hp (31.6kw) @ 11,000rpm
-
Claimed torque - 28.7 N-m (2.93kgf-m) @ 8,500rpm
-
Very oversquare bore/stroke ratio of 77.0 x 53.6 mm ensures high reliability at high rpm. Rev limiter prevents over-revving.
-
Forged 2-ring piston is tin plated to reduce wear and the piston skirts have microscopic grooves to ensure oil retention and low friction.
-
Billet camshafts are carburised for durability and operate alloy tool steel tappets. Cam profiles designed for wide power band and high peak power.
-
Lightweight titanium valves (IN: 31 mm; EX: 25 mm) for high-rpm reliability. Oxidising treatment to valves reduces wear.
-
37 mm Keihin FCR flat-slide carburettor is equipped with TPS. Accelerator pump contributes to quick throttle response. Handle grip and throttle cables
changed to suit the push-pull style carb.
-
Reed valve located between the crankcase and the transmission case reduces pumping loss for high output and quick response.
-
Oil pump uses a 29 x 4 mm feed rotor and a 29 x 10 mm scavenge rotor.
-
Semi-dry-sump design keeps oil away from the crankshaft to reduce windage loss and contributes to a lower centre of gravity and reduced weight.
-
Oil feed to top end is internal, via the bolt passageways. This design eliminates the weight and complexity of external oil lines.
-
One-piece water pump/oil filter cover saves weight and adds to compactness.
-
The shaft on which the kick-start idler gear spins also functions as a crankcase breather. Holes in the shaft and gear create a centrifugal breather
that evacuates air from the transmission cavity.
-
AC-CDI ignition uses TPS (Throttle Position Sensor) and a 3D ignition map to provide ideal ignition timing for various engine conditions. During
acceleration and deceleration, the system makes adjustments to the 3D ignition map, resulting in improved acceleration performance and smooth engine braking.
-
Quick-shifting 5-speed transmission uses a ratchet shift mechanism for a light shift touch. The ratchet mechanism uses a “phased” shift holder to
compensate for the different shift effort riders tend to use when up-shifting and down-shifting.
-
Optional rotors will be available to allow riders to alter the amount of engine inertia to suit riding style and track conditions.
-
Transmission gears are made of tough DSG-2 (Daido Super Steel for Gears #2).
-
Lightweight exhaust system features a titanium exhaust pipe “stepped”
to a slightly larger diameter stainless steel pipe. Lightweight silencer has aluminium body and stainless steel interior. End cap resists mud plugging.
-
Automatic centrifugal decompression system fitted to exhaust cam lifts one exhaust valve to ease starting.
-
A hot start system gives quick starts when the engine is hot. The hot start lever is unitised with the clutch lever.
-
An optional cable set-up will allow manual operation of the decompressor (via a lever on the right handle grip). This makes it easier to clear a
“flooded” engine.
-
“Metafoam” gaskets used to ease maintenance chores.
